DBG$HELP.HLB  —  DEBUG  Messages  BADSIGARG
 bad sigarg pointer at pointer-addr or bad sigarg vector, can't read
 sigarg vector near sigarg-addr

    Facility: DEBUG, VMS Debugger

    Explanation: The debugger is attempting to chain down the call
    stack, following frame pointers, and has encountered an exception
    handler. The signal argument pointer at location pointer-addr
    points to a signal argument vector at least part of which is not
    read accessible near location sigarg-addr.

    User Action: Determine what part of your code is overwriting
    the stored signal argument pointer on the call stack, or part
    of the signal argument vector itself, and correct it. Since the
    debugger looks at the call stack to symbolize addresses, you may
    suppress some of these messages by typing the command "SET MODE
    NOSYMBOLIC".
